Out of the 65 companies that are launching products and services this week, there are a number of mobile-related startups in the mix. Interestingly, there are several startups that are launching simple iPhone and mobile app creation services. The apps allow for a centralized location for group activities and schedules, and even incorporates social media and check-in technologies. AppVoyage is rolling out AppBlox, which uses a self-service, simple drag and drop technology to build mobile apps and advertising campaigns. Called dynamic ridesharing, the applications will keep track of traffic in real time, will connect users with open seats in cars within their network, let them send requests to be picked up, and coordinates messaging between drivers and pick-ups.
